Acupuncture
Acupuncture has been practised for thousands of years, with many of its core principles outlined in the Huangdi Neijing. This ancient text explains how health depends on the smooth flow of Qi through the body’s meridian pathways.

Cupping/Gua Sha
Cupping and Gua Sha are Traditional Chinese healing techniques that help improve circulation, release tension, and support the body’s natural healing.
Chinese Herbal Medicine
Chinese Herbal Medicine is a traditional healing practice that uses natural plant-based botanicals to support health and restore balance in the body.
